What to Look for in a Robot Vacuum and Mop
Before diving into the leading choices, it's vital to understand the key functions to consider when picking a robot vacuum and mop:
Suction Power: The suction power determines how effectively the robot can get dirt and particles. Try to find designs with a minimum of 2000Pa of suction power for optimum efficiency.Battery Life: A longer battery life means the robot can clean up bigger areas without needing to recharge. Q1: Are robot vacuums and mops suitable for homes with animals?
A1: Yes, many robot vacuums and mops are developed to deal with pet hair and dander effectively. Try to find designs with strong suction power and specialized pet cleaning modes.
Q2: Can robot vacuums and mops clean all kinds of floors?
A2: Most robot vacuums and mops are flexible and can clean various floor types, consisting of hardwood, tile, and carpet. Nevertheless, some designs might perform better on particular surfaces. Inspect the producer's requirements for the best outcomes.
Q3: How frequently should I clean up the robot vacuum and mop?
A3: It's advised to empty the dustbin and clean the filters after each usage. The water tank and mopping pads must be cleaned up and changed frequently to keep health and performance.
Q4: Can I control the robot vacuum and mop with voice commands?
A4: Yes, lots of models work with sm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, permitting you to manage them with voice commands.
Q5: Are robot vacuums and mops energy-efficient?
A5: Generally, robot vacuums and mops are created to be energy-efficient, with most designs using less power than standard vacuum cleaners. However, battery life and energy consumption can vary in between designs.
